## Support

Log compaction in Pipewren runs as a background sweeper that merges segment files once a topic exceeds its retention threshold. If compaction stalls, you will see disk usage climb steadily on the broker nodes while the `compaction_lag` metric flatlines. Before escalating, capture the sweeper logs from the affected broker and note the topic name and partition count. The Pipewren platform team owns this subsystem and triages issues quickly; send your findings to the address below.

escalation mailbox, hadug-bajog: sormir@norvalabs.internal

Meeting Notes — Key-Card Stock, Harrowgate Annex (excerpt)

Attendees reviewed the key-card inventory for the new Harrowgate Annex site. Current stock covers initial staffing; a further batch of 200 blanks has been ordered from Calderon Print Systems and is expected midweek. Records team to log each batch number on receipt and store blanks in the locked cabinet in Room 4. Transfer of the first 50 programmed cards will go by bonded courier on Thursday. The courier hand-over instruction for that run follows below.

courier memo of fadug-tajop: the gorir sorael courier leaves the istys ledger at gate 1509 under passcode 497843

Subject: Key rotation for the Pebbletide bloom filter

Hi all — quick heads-up before Thursday's sync: we rotated the credential for the bloom filter sitting in front of the Cairnstore KV cluster. Old key dies Friday noon. If your service queries the filter directly (looking at you, batch team), update your config before then or enjoy a flood of pointless KV lookups. New key is below.

service key, fawip-bajef: kto11_Qt5wZK9vdNC